Cannabinoid Profile
Green Room features a robust cannabinoid profile that exemplifies its balanced hybrid nature, offering consumers a well-rounded experience with both potent effects and nuanced therapeutic benefits. Laboratory analyses typically place its THC content in the range of 18% to 25%, making it a potent choice for experienced users who appreciate both cerebral stimulation and corporeal relaxation. Alongside high THC levels, a low but significant presence of CBD has been recorded, typically around 1-2%, which can play an important role in modulating the psychoactive effects.
Recent studies have shown that strains with such balanced cannabinoid profiles tend to promote a smoother transition between psychoactive and medicinal effects. For instance, a study published by the Journal of Cannabis Research noted that balanced hybrids similar to Green Room are associated with a more harmonious blend of euphoria and relaxation with fewer risks of anxiety in sensitive users. These data points not only validate the strain’s effectiveness but also empower users to make informed choices regarding their consumption.
Furthermore, advanced chromatography tests have revealed the presence of other cannabinoids, such as CBG and CBC, albeit in smaller concentrations, which may contribute to anti-inflammatory and analgesic properties. Notably, these accessory cannabinoids have been observed to occur in concentrations that can reach up to 5% collectively in premium samples. These figures, when compared with industry benchmarks, place Green Room in a competitive position among hybrid strains designed for both recreational and therapeutic use.
The intricate cannabinoid interplay offers a unique and consistently replicable psychophysiological experience that has been corroborated by breeders and medical professionals alike. This data-driven approach to strain development is part of what sets Best Coast Genetics apart in an increasingly sophisticated market.
Terpene Profile
Green Room’s terpene profile is as meticulously engineered as its genetic lineage, offering a complex bouquet that plays a pivotal role in its overall sensory and therapeutic experience. Detailed g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S) analyses have identified a significant presence of myrcene, limonene, and caryophyllene; each of these terpenes contributes uniquely to the strain’s profile. In many tested samples, myrcene has been measured at levels where it can account for roughly 30% of the total terpene content, a figure that underscores its fundamental importance in the strain’s composition.
Limonene, another key terpene in Green Room, is responsible for the strain’s bright citrus notes, and in certain batches, its concentration has been reported to be as high as 25% of the overall terpene synthesis. This is in line with similar high-quality strains reviewed on platforms such as Leafly and Seedsman, where limonene is credited with inducing mood-lifting effects and stress relief. Caryophyllene, albeit present in slightly lower quantities, adds a subtle spicy warmth and has been noted to contribute significantly to anti-inflammatory benefits.
Terpenes, by definition, are volatile aromatic compounds that not only define flavor and aroma but also modulate the effects of cannabinoids in what is known as the entourage effect. Scientific literature suggests that the optimal ratio of these compounds in a balanced hybrid like Green Room can enhance the strain’s overall efficacy for both recreational enjoyment and medicinal applications. Independent research has documented that terpenes in modern cannabis strains can vary up to 15% between different harvests; however, the precise breeding techniques of Best Coast Genetics have minimized this variability in Green Room.
The consistency in terpene production is a hallmark of Green Room, rooted in its genetic stability and precision-driven cultivation practices. This consistency is confirmed by both in-house labs and independent testers, with variance typically within a 5% range—an impressive feat that many breeders aspire to achieve. Overall, the terpene profile of Green Room not only defines its sensory appeal but also enriches its pharmacological potential.
